Glenn Vernon Akers
Glenn Vernon Akers
Central City
Glenn V. Akers, 76, passed away June 24, 2025 at home surrounded by family after a short battle with cancer. He was born April 7, 1949 in Princeton, Minnesota to Vernon and Annabelle (Ziebarth) Akers. He spent his childhood and teen years growing up in Central City, Iowa with his siblings Gary, Marilyn and Larry.
He attended a one-room schoolhouse, No. 8 (Rollins) in rural Central City, Iowa, later attending Central City Community school. His family moved to Spencer Brook, Minnesota in 1965. He graduated from Princeton High School in 1967.
He spent the majority of his working career as a cement mason, traveling and living in multiple states across the U.S. His many tales revealed a life well lived and traveled.
He was preceded in death by his grandparents Frank and Alice (Peterson) Ziebarth and Jeremiah and Vinelandis (Sheppard) Akers, parents Vernon “Buster” and Annabelle Akers, brother and sister-in-law Gary and Joanie (Biniek) Akers, many aunts, uncles and cousins.
Survivors include his sister Marilyn (Michael) Trunk and brother Larry (Lori) Akers, nieces and nephews Jason (Melinda) and Erik (Rebecca) Akers, John Bergmann, Jennifer (Jon) Moos, Jacquelyn, Jeremiah (Sharma) Luedke, Josh and Jillian Luedke, Angela (Tim) Alexander and Alesha Akers, aunt Mary (Ziebarth) Mattson, uncle Larry Ziebarth, many great-nieces and -nephews, cousins and friends.
Per Glenn’s request a private family burial is planned at Baldwin Cemetery, Baldwin, Minnesota.
